Session Description:
How does someone working in the creative community stay inspired? I am not talking about being inspired by others work, but rather sustaining a level of personal inspiration that motivates us on a daily basis to go forth and create on the highest level possible.
It’s often said you cannot teach someone creativity and in general that is true. But you can teach them how to facilitate and grow their creative potential and indirectly increase creativity and that is what this session is all about.
Being a creative person has more to do with a lifestyle than it does a job. I’ll show the attenders how they can practically approach every day situations of life with a creative curiosity and discover and capitalize on these moments of inspiration.
About the Presenter:
Von is principal of Glitschka Studios and has worked in the communication arts industry for over 23 years. His work reflects the symbiotic relationship between design and illustration. This duality of skills within his creative arsenal, inspired his title of “Illustrative Designer.”
In 2002, he founded Glitschka Studios, a multi-disciplinary creative firm. The studio shines as a hired gun for both in-house art departments and medium to large creative agencies working on projects for such clients as Microsoft, Adobe, Pepsi, Rock & Roll Hall of Fame, MLB and NBA Licenses, Johnson & Johnson, Bandai Toys, Merck, John Wayne Foundation, Disney, Lifetime Television and HGTV.
